Using the Format Painter
This PowerPoint is part of our 60 second tips series
If you need to copy the format from one area of your document or spreadsheet to another, then using the Format Painter is the simplest way.
The Format Painter is on the Home ribbon.First, choose the format you want to copy by clicking that area of the document or spreadsheet. Then select the Format Painter.
Your cursor will change to this icon.
Drag the icon over the text you wish to change, then let go of your mouse button. If you double-click the Format Painter the painter will stay on until you press the escape key (Esc) on your keyboard or click the icon once more.
The Format Painter works on all parts of your documents including Heading Styles and Picture Borders.
